Company Snapshot

Burchgrove Home Pty Ltd is an Australian-based procurement and distribution entity headquartered in Braemar, New South Wales. It operates primarily as a buyer of home & personal care products for domestic retail and wholesale channels. The company functions as a downstream supply chain integrator — sourcing consistently from a single supplier country (Philippines) and concentrating purchases across a narrow set of HS-coded product categories. Its trade activity shows strong temporal continuity, with verified shipments totaling 2,650 in the past 12 months and consistent monthly transaction frequency since mid-2024.

HS Code Analysis

Data interpretation shows pronounced product focus within two harmonized categories: HS 3307 (perfumed/medicated soaps & bath preparations) and HS 3406 (artificial waxes & cleaning preparations), collectively representing 70.3% of all transactions. Notably, newer HS codes (e.g., 33074990000 and 34060000000) show ‘New’ status and recent activity (May 2026), indicating active product line expansion or regulatory reclassification — not replacement. The persistence of older 8-digit codes alongside newer 11-digit variants suggests parallel use of legacy and updated tariff lines, possibly due to customs modernization in the Philippines. This dual-code usage signals evolving compliance practices and potential new product introductions under refined classifications.
